6. Engaging in Eco-Friendly Shore Excursions

Rear view of couple in hats during the cruise. Photo Credit: Envato @gpointstudio

Shore excursions are a highlight of any cruise, offering the chance to explore new destinations and cultures. However, these activities can also have a significant environmental impact. To ensure your excursions are eco-friendly, consider options that emphasize sustainability and conservation. Many cruise lines offer excursions designed to minimize environmental impact, such as hiking tours, wildlife watching, and cultural experiences led by local guides. Choosing eco-friendly excursions not only supports sustainable tourism but also provides a more authentic and rewarding travel experience. By engaging with local communities and participating in conservation-focused activities, you gain a deeper understanding of the region's natural and cultural heritage. Additionally, eco-friendly excursions often promote responsible tourism practices, such as respecting wildlife and minimizing disturbance to natural habitats. By opting for these experiences, you contribute to the preservation of the destinations you visit, ensuring they remain vibrant and thriving for future generations.
